Sixty seconds before a meeting

Press start, say the sentence you are going to open the meeting with, and look at the hold figure. If it sits between -20 and -9 dBFS you are set. If it sits at −35, everyone will spend the call asking you to repeat yourself and blaming their speakers. If it pins at the top, your consonants are already distorting and no amount of “can you turn your volume down” from anyone else will fix it, because the damage happened at your end.

Band Peak range What MicTester tells you
Nothing arriving below -50 dBFS Below −50 dBFS there is no usable speech in the signal. Either the wrong input is selected, the device is muted in hardware, or nobody is talking.
Too quiet -50 to -20 dBFS Audible, but the far end will strain. Raise the input gain until your loudest speech peaks land above −20 dBFS.
On target -20 to -9 dBFS Speech peaks belong in this window. It is the band between the alignment level and the permitted maximum, so you have headroom for a laugh or a cough.
Hot -9 to -0.5 dBFS Loud enough that a sudden peak can hit the ceiling. Fine if your speech only touches this band; back the gain off if it lives here.
Clipping risk -0.5 dBFS and above At the ceiling. Anything louder cannot be represented and comes out as distortion that no amount of processing downstream will remove.

Where these four boundaries come from. −50, −20, −9 and −0.5 dBFS are the thresholds OBS Studio publishes for its own input-level indicator, in the knowledge-base article “Audio Mixer Technical Details” dated 2022-02-13, read directly on 2026-08-15. MicTester reuses them so a reading here means what a reading there means. The band names and the advice in the last column are this site’s own reading of those levels — they are a scale we declare, not a survey of anyone’s microphones, and we have measured no population to support them. Zoom does not publish a target level for its Input volume bar, so this page uses the same reference marks a streamer would — and applies them to the reading from your machine, not to an average of anyone else’s.

Every Zoom audio control, and what it does to the signal

The path is Zoom desktop app → your profile picture in the top-right corner → Settings → the Audio tab. Every control below is named as Zoom’s own documentation names it.

Control names, locations and behaviour from Zoom Support, “Testing your audio settings for Zoom meetings” (article KB0062765; the page states it was updated 2025-09-09); Zoom Support, “Changing settings in the Zoom Workplace desktop and mobile app” (article KB0060612; the page states it was updated 2026-06-29). Checked on 2026-08-15. Both articles describe the Zoom Workplace desktop app. Web-client and Zoom Rooms wording differs and was not checked.
Control Where What it does Browser equivalent
Microphone drop-down Settings → Audio → Microphone Chooses the capture device. deviceId
Test microphone Settings → Audio → Microphone Records a short clip and plays it back while the Input volume bar moves — the same loop this page runs, inside the app. none
Input volume Settings → Audio → Microphone Manual level. Zoom’s documentation states this slider becomes unavailable while automatic adjustment is on. none
Automatically adjust microphone volume Settings → Audio → Microphone Zoom’s own advice: if your audio fades in and out, consider turning this off. That symptom is what gain control sounds like when it is fighting the room. autoGainControl
Microphone modes → Noise removal (default) Settings → Audio → Microphone modes Zoom states that by default the app applies noise suppression and echo cancellation, and that the level of background-noise suppression is adjustable. noiseSuppression
Microphone modes → Original sound for musicians Settings → Audio → Microphone modes Captures a fuller range of sound for music, and Zoom notes that noise suppression is turned off in this mode. noiseSuppression: false
Test speaker and microphone The join dialog, before you enter a meeting Runs the ringtone-then-playback pair without joining audio first. none

The gain-control trap

Automatic gain control is the reason so many Zoom microphone problems are hard to pin down, and it is worth understanding before you change anything. With it on, a badly set microphone still sounds roughly correct: the app quietly multiplies a weak signal up until it looks like everyone else’s. What you get in exchange is a level that moves on its own — loud when the room is quiet, ducking when it is not — and a noise floor that comes up with the voice.

Zoom names the symptom itself. Its settings documentation says that if your audio fades in and out, consider disabling Automatically adjust microphone volume. That is gain control hunting. This page leaves the equivalent browser switch on by default so the behaviour matches your meeting; switch it off and watch the meter drop to your real level. Whatever you see then is the level you should be fixing at the device, and the quiet-microphone page works out the gain you are missing in dB.

Microphone modes, in plain terms

Zoom’s Microphone modes section replaces what used to be a scatter of tick boxes. Three choices matter for a mic test.

  • Noise removal is the default, and Zoom describes it as its own software processing with adjustable background-noise suppression. This is the mode almost everyone is in.
  • Personalized audio isolation uses a voiceprint and is documented as being for crowded environments. It is stronger processing, not lighter.
  • Original sound for musicians captures a fuller range and, in Zoom’s own words, turns noise suppression off. If you are demonstrating an instrument, singing, or diagnosing what your microphone genuinely sounds like, this is the mode — and it is the closest match to this page with the noise-suppression switch off.

Zoom also documents an Audio profile option, Live performance audio, which it says aims to reduce audio latency between participants to roughly 30–50 ms and which disables the microphone-mode settings when enabled. That is Zoom’s figure for its own mode, not a measurement of ours; if you want to see where delay comes from in the first place, the microphone latency page shows the buffer arithmetic.

Symptom to setting

  • “You’re very quiet.” Peak below −30 dBFS here. Fix the gain at the device, then in Windows, then let Zoom’s slider do the last few dB.
  • “You keep dropping out.” Level near the floor with gain control on: the app is gating what it cannot distinguish from noise. Get the raw level up.
  • “You sound tinny / far away.” Wrong device. A laptop lid array while you wear a headset sounds exactly like this. Check the device list here.
  • “There’s an echo of us.” You are on speakers. Echo cancellation is on by default in Zoom, but it can only do so much; headphones end the problem.
  • “You cut out at the start of every sentence.” Noise suppression deciding your first syllable is not speech. Test it with the switch above.

What this page cannot tell you about Zoom

It cannot see inside a meeting. Zoom applies its own processing and its own codec after the point this page ends, so a clip that sounds perfect here can still arrive compressed on a poor connection. It also cannot check your speaker, which is the other half of “nobody can hear me” — Zoom’s Test speaker button plays a tone for exactly that. What this page does prove is that the microphone, the cable, the operating system and the browser are all delivering your voice, which is the half of the problem people waste the most time on.

FAQ

Zoom mic questions

How do I test my mic in Zoom without joining a meeting?

Zoom documents two ways. Before entering a meeting, the join dialog offers Test speaker and microphone, which plays a ringtone and then records and replays you. Outside a meeting, sign in and go to Settings → Audio, where Test microphone records a clip and plays it back while the Input volume bar moves. This page does the same loop without opening Zoom, which is the faster check when you are about to be late.

My Zoom audio fades in and out. Which setting is that?

Almost certainly Automatically adjust microphone volume, which is automatic gain control: it fades when it cannot decide whether the quiet stretch is you pausing or the room getting louder. Zoom’s own settings documentation names this symptom and this setting, quoted under the gain-control trap below. Turn the automatic gain switch off on this page and talk — if the fading stops, you have found it.

Why is the Input volume slider greyed out in Zoom?

Because automatic adjustment is on. Zoom states that the Input volume slider is unavailable while Automatically adjust microphone volume is enabled — the app is setting the level and will not let you fight it. Turn the automatic setting off and the slider comes back.

Does Zoom always apply noise suppression?

By default, yes. Zoom’s documentation states that the app uses noise suppression and echo cancellation by default to improve the audio quality received by your microphone, and that the level of background-noise suppression is adjustable under Microphone modes. The exception it names is Original sound for musicians, which captures a fuller range of sound and, in Zoom’s own words, turns noise suppression off.

What level should my voice hit before a Zoom call?

Aim for your loudest normal speech to peak between -20 and -9 dBFS on the meter above. Zoom’s Input volume bar is not calibrated in dBFS, so it cannot give you a number — it tells you the microphone is picking something up, not whether the level is right. That is the gap this page fills.

Zoom hears nothing but this page works. What now?

Then the microphone, the operating system and the browser are all fine, and something inside Zoom is pointed elsewhere. Check the Microphone drop-down in Settings → Audio against the device names in the Input device tab here — they come from the same operating system, so they match. If Zoom cannot see a device this page lists, that is an app-permission problem, and Zoom’s own article sends Windows users to Microphone privacy settings.
